3rd DHECA Workshop in Valencia: Innovation in heritage through imaging techniques and the FORTHEM Alliance SDP “ARchive of Time” WebAR, alongside experts from the Lucian Blaga University of Sibiu.
The DHECA project continues its journey in specialised training with the hosting of its 3rd Interdisciplinary Workshop. The event, held at the Art Laboratory of the Faculty of Geography and History at the University of Valencia, will bring together local and international experts to explore the frontiers of digital conservation.
A technical foundation for digital conservation
The day will begin at 4:00 pm with a session dedicated to “Documentation and Imaging Techniques”. This technical block will be led by Carmen Cano and Álvaro Solbes, researchers from the University of Valencia and members of the ChemiNova EU Horizon Europe team. Attendees will delve into the latest imaging methodologies applied to cultural heritage—an essential tool for ensuring precision in contemporary documentation projects.
“ARchive of Time”: Travelling to the Middle Ages through WebAR
From 6:30 pm, the workshop will take on an international dimension with the presentation of “ARchive of Time”, an award-winning project from the FORTHEM Alliance Student Driven Programme. This session will analyse how the use of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R) technologies can increase public engagement with history.
To conclude, there will be an interactive demo where participants can use their own mobile devices to scan QR codes placed around the room, experiencing first-hand WebAR technology applied to the Council Tower of Sibiu and its defensive system.
Guest Experts: Academic Excellence and Digital Entrepreneurship
For this edition, we are joined by distinguished profiles from the Lucian Blaga University of Sibiu (Romania):
Lect. Dr Răzvan Codruț Pop A lecturer in the Department of History, Heritage, and Protestant Theology at the aforementioned university. His teaching covers areas such as Romanian medieval art history, architectural heritage, and modern universal art history.
-
Specialisation: PhD in History; expert in the urban evolution of Transylvanian medieval towns.
-
Cultural Management: He currently serves as the manager of the ASTRA County Library in Sibiu, combining his role as an academic researcher with the management and promotion of regional historical heritage.
Costel Roșu A student specialising in Heritage Studies and Cultural Property Management. His focus lies in the application of digital technologies to revitalise history.
-
Leadership: Founder of the AURAUX Association, an NGO dedicated to heritage promotion through innovative methods.
-
Innovation: The driver and manager of the ARchive of Time project, which allows users to rediscover the evolution of the Council Tower of Sibiu via digitally reconstructed 3D models accessible in five languages.
